It’s been 6 months since his lung surgery and stroke in February and 3 months since we found out what the real problem was in May. After the successful trip and surgery in MN last month, Zap and I now feel that it’s time to end this thread. I’m talking fairly well, but if things get too crazy and jumbled, I just say that I’ve had a stroke... After the stroke I could only ski very cautiously, but after the surgery in July, I’ve begun to train again and hope to get more comfortable with my skiing as I get stronger.
There is only one solution, i.e. the procedure done at the Mayo Clinic, and there is a 50% chance of re-narrowing. So we/they will watch it closely. In 3 months I will have to get a follow-up test and if all goes well another test at the one year point; otherwise we go back to Mayo for a repeat procedure. The surgeons at Mayo, my cardiologist and pulmonologist in Bellevue, and my rehab therapists at Evergreen all tell me I’m their star patient and am ready to go it on my own. My two doctors in Bellevue are both backcountry and downhill skiers, so that is good. I have many positive thoughts about my condition and my progress and a very positive outlook. I’m looking forward to doing ‘normal’ trip reports this fall!
We want to thank you all for your support and encouragement.
